Sony PMC-D407L Service manual
Sony PMC-D407L is an audio system that combines a CD player, cassette recorder, radio, and speakers into one compact unit. The CD player features CLV (constant linear velocity) technology for smooth playback, as well as the ability to play both standard and MP3 CDs. The cassette recorder offers 4-track 2-channel stereo recording and playback, with fast winding for quick navigation. The radio tuner covers a wide range of frequencies, including FM, AM, and LW/MW bands, with RDS (Radio Data System) support for displaying station information.
